Oregon State Police Trooper Discusses Drug Interdiction, DRE Expertise, and Fallen Officers Foundation

Trooper Charlie Rolfe of the Oregon State Police discussed his role as a canine handler for drug detection, the types of drugs his dog Orr is trained to detect (cocaine, meth, heroin, fentanyl), and how drug trafficking operates in Oregon, with cartels importing drugs from Mexico and distributing them through stash houses. He highlighted that the drug business is larger than American agriculture by monetary value. Rolfe also detailed the process of traffic stops for suspected drug transport, including using dog alerts as probable cause for searches, the legal nuances of obtaining warrants in Oregon, and the challenges of drug interdiction work. He touched upon the prevalence of fentanyl and meth as the primary drugs of concern on Eastern Oregon highways. Furthermore, Rolfe elaborated on his training as a Drug Recognition Expert (DRE), the rigorous process involved, and how DREs assist in DUI cases where alcohol is not a factor. He also shared his personal journey into law enforcement, his military service, and his involvement with the Oregon Fallen Badge Foundation, which supports families of officers killed in the line of duty or active duty deaths. He explained the foundation's funding through fundraisers like a ball and auction, and a golf tournament, and his current role as a statewide vice president. Finally, Rolfe described the operational areas for Oregon State Police in Eastern Oregon, emphasizing their role as a resource for local agencies, and reflected on the rewarding aspects of his job, including helping people and seeing former arrestees become productive citizens.
